Description

"Plutarch's Lives, Volume 1" is a timeless collection of biographies that brings to life the remarkable individuals who shaped the ancient world. Written by the renowned historian and philosopher Plutarch, this volume offers an intimate glimpse into the lives of influential figures from ancient Greece and Rome, including legends like Alexander the Great, Julius Caesar, and Cleopatra. Through Plutarch's vivid storytelling, readers are transported to the distant past, where the triumphs, tragedies, and moral complexities of these historical giants are revealed. Plutarch's Lives, Volume 1 is not just a historical account but a profound reflection on the human spirit, leadership, and the pursuit of virtue. Each biography is a window into the character and achievements of these great men and women, offering valuable lessons that resonate with readers today.
